Roost Rotisserie Chicken and Latin Cuisine in Saint Augustine
Last inspected:
525 Fl 16 Unit 110, Saint Augustine, FL 32084Roost Rotisserie Chicken and Latin Cuisine has been inspected 12 times since April 2022, accumulating 29 violations with no emergency closures. The facility averaged 2.4 violations per inspection, below the Florida statewide average of 5.2. Violations span employee health policy (appearing in 2 of the past 3 inspections), handwashing facilities (cited 3 times in July 2025), chemical storage (4 citations across the record), and food contact surface sanitation. The most recent inspection on January 27, 2026 documented 4 basic violations across employee health policy, time as control, food contact surfaces, and allergen awareness, with the disposition Inspection Completed - No Further Action.
Summary generated from Florida DBPR public inspection records.
